Alonso praises 'scientific' Honda approach

– McLaren driver Fernando Alonso says he has been left impressed by engine partner Honda's "scientific" approach, which he believes is well-matched to Formula 1's current technical regulations.Alonso has joined McLaren-Honda after five seasons at Ferrari, during which time he failed to add to the two world titles he achieved with Renault in 2005 and 2006.From his early experience of working with the Japanese brand, and visiting its research and development facility in Sakura, he has noticed marked differences compared to rival teams."I saw a lot of talented people in Honda when I visited the facilities in Sakura," said Alonso.
